Full Job Description
The Staff Attorney - Private Funds will assist Associates, Counsel, and Partners in various funds matters, including reviewing and preparing documents and agreements for fundraising, secondary transfers, and ongoing fund maintenance.

Responsibilities
  • Assist with fund formation and document drafting for a range of private fund clients
  • Review and track investor subscription documents
  • Assist with investor onboarding
  • Manage fund closings
  • Prepare basic funds-related agreements, including transfer agreements
  • Work with clients and investors to process and close secondary transfers
  • Compile key documents including master side letters and most favored nation clause compendiums
  • Assist with AML and KYC review and compliance
  • Assist with ongoing fund and compliance work
  • Other tasks as needed
